Perl crawl website and download files

This option tells Wget to delete every single file it downloads, after having done so. It does not issue the ' DELE ' command to remote FTP sites, for instance.

28 Nov 2018 The web is constantly changing and sometimes sites are deleted as the all-inclusive downloaded copy of a website (including all resources 

They are both command line tool that can download files via various my $url = 'https://perlmaven.com/';; my $html = qx{wget --quiet --output-document=- $url};.

One of its applications is to download a file from web using the file URL. Installation: First In this example, we first crawl the webpage to extract. all the links and  with CGI variables, PERL code, shell commands, and executable scripts (on-line and getcount-3.0.0.cgi, This script scans through the site's counter file looking for the url you requested. getRFC_3.pl, getRFC - This script downloads RFC's from faqs.org and put them in the current directory. Able to crawl entire sites. 29 Jan 2018 The Guide was a directory of other websites, organized in a Web Crawling mostly refers to downloading and storing the contents of a structured format and load it to a file or database for subsequent use. It is easier with Scripting languages such as Javascript (Node.js), PHP, Perl, Ruby or Python. 24 Jun 2019 Trying to Crawl a JavaScript Website Without Rendering Instead of simply downloading and parsing a HTML file, the crawler essentially  8 jobs World's largest website for Perl Jobs. Find $$$ Perl Jobs or hire a Perl Developer to bid on your Perl Job at Freelancer. The output should be a pipe (|) delimited file with the following column mappings: origin_city ftp files , perl show elapsed time end script , perl cgi import file , crawl website perl example , perl aes  The most simple task is to download a given URL. possibilites, but you might want to download all the JavaScript files, or all the movies, or . Crawling web sites way to download many web pages using Perl: LWP::Simple and HTTP::Tiny  A web crawling framework for Perl. Contribute to jamadam/WWW-Crawler-Mojo development by creating an account on GitHub. Find file. Clone or download 

spider.pl spider.config > output.txt # or using the default config file But, you can configure the spider to spider multiple sites in a single run. Load the LWP::Bundle via the CPAN.pm shell, or download libwww-perl-x.xx from CPAN (or via  21 Jan 2013 Let's call our project mojo-crawler.pl . URL revisiting (don't download the same resource over and over);; Cross-domain links (not allowed). This tutorial will show you step-by-step how to create a bulk website downloader in Perl. For Red Hen projects, this is useful for downloading subtitle files or  One of its applications is to download a file from web using the file URL. Installation: First In this example, we first crawl the webpage to extract. all the links and  with CGI variables, PERL code, shell commands, and executable scripts (on-line and getcount-3.0.0.cgi, This script scans through the site's counter file looking for the url you requested. getRFC_3.pl, getRFC - This script downloads RFC's from faqs.org and put them in the current directory. Able to crawl entire sites. 29 Jan 2018 The Guide was a directory of other websites, organized in a Web Crawling mostly refers to downloading and storing the contents of a structured format and load it to a file or database for subsequent use. It is easier with Scripting languages such as Javascript (Node.js), PHP, Perl, Ruby or Python.

document. This must be a Perl compatible regular expression. crawler.max_download_size, Maximum size of files crawler will download (in MB). Default:  21 Mar 2012 posted on social networking sites.2 Academia has followed suit. Program 1 presents a Perl program that downloads the master files of the  There are many CPAN mirror sites; you should use the one closest to you, There are eight main modules in LWP: File, Font, HTML, HTTP, LWP, MIME, URI, If you downloaded this program from the O'Reilly web site, you could then use it  Don't crash if download fails. – Timeout mechanism responding, file not found, and other errors Ex. Perl modules: Lingua::Stem and Lingua::Stem::Snowball Need to obtain Base URL from HTTP header, or HTML. Meta tag, or else  If you were to build a web based website crawler, what scripting language would you choose and why? what it does is it extracts the content of the web page and loads it into the file system. Python/Perl - Easy to develop has a lot of libraries. Please download the complete source code from below my tech blog link. Related: How to download this webpage with Wget? & Using wget to curl www.target-url.com -c cookie.txt then will save a file named cookie.txt. But you Also (and originally) available in Perl, if that is more your cup of tea. The downloaded file is re-named to master.xml and saved to the Note: If the service pack needs to replace any configuration files or Perl scripts that you Launch a web browser, and navigate to the URL corresponding to install.html, e.g. 12693: Need to be able to specify wild card path to crawl in addition to date range 

with CGI variables, PERL code, shell commands, and executable scripts (on-line and getcount-3.0.0.cgi, This script scans through the site's counter file looking for the url you requested. getRFC_3.pl, getRFC - This script downloads RFC's from faqs.org and put them in the current directory. Able to crawl entire sites.

Web scraping, web harvesting, or web data extraction is data scraping used for extracting data Fetching is the downloading of a page (which a browser does when you view the page). Therefore, web crawling is a main component of web scraping, to fetch pages for later processing. Once fetched, then extraction can take  If you have perl in mind i can recommend Web::Scraper [3]. try scrapy.. its open tools here i attached pdf file link and download link. in public data gathering (web harvesting) from open access websites by programming a web-crawler. Web scraping, web harvesting, or web data extraction is data scraping used for extracting data Fetching is the downloading of a page (which a browser does when you view the page). Therefore, web crawling is a main component of web scraping, to fetch pages for later processing. Once fetched, then extraction can take  2 May 2010 We need to scrape data (web scraping) from some websites with Perl for a school project. The other part of the code just loops over the array with my scraped data and prints it to the screen and saves it into a file. URL. Just like a mini crawler Windows batch file f… on Download file with PowerShell. 8 Feb 2019 By doing so, the website crawler can update the search engine index website crawl are in a TSV file, which can be downloaded and used with Excel. implemented in coding schemes using Perl, Python, C, and C# alike.

21 Mar 2012 posted on social networking sites.2 Academia has followed suit. Program 1 presents a Perl program that downloads the master files of the 

This tutorial will show you step-by-step how to create a bulk website downloader in Perl. For Red Hen projects, this is useful for downloading subtitle files or 

21 Mar 2012 posted on social networking sites.2 Academia has followed suit. Program 1 presents a Perl program that downloads the master files of the